How to Choose the Right Precision Metal Stamping Suppliers?
In metal parts manufacturing, the choice of a stamping supplier directly impacts product quality, production efficiency, and cost control. Many companies encounter problems such as substandard stamping precision, delayed delivery, and unhelpful after-sales service due to unthinkingly selecting stamping suppliers. In fact, we can find a reliable precision metal stamping manufacturer based on four core dimensions—qualifications, technical capabilities, quality control, and service guarantees to avoid cooperation risks.
Basic Qualifications and Production Capacity of Precision Metal Stamping Suppliers
A legitimate precision metal stamping supplier must possess the necessary industry qualifications and a production scale matching the required needs. First, check the business license’s scope of business to confirm whether it includes “metal stamping processing” or related categories, avoiding unlicensed small workshops. If the products are used in specialized fields such as automotive or medical applications, it’s also necessary to verify whether they have ISO 9001 quality system certification and IATF 16949 certification for the automotive industry. These qualifications are fundamental guarantees of standardized processing.
Regarding production capacity, focus on the equipment configuration and production capacity of the metal stamping factory. High-quality precision stamping manufacturers are equipped with multi-specification presses (such as 100-500 ton servo punch presses), high-precision stamping dies processing equipment (slow wire cutting, EDM), and automated feeding and testing equipment to meet the stamping needs of metal parts with different complexities. At the same time, it is important to understand their average daily production capacity and order schedule to determine whether they can match your delivery cycle.
Stamping Dies’ R&D Capabilities of the Precision Metal Stamping Manufacturer

Dies are the soul of metal stamping. The stamping dies design and manufacturing capabilities of a metal stamping manufacturer directly determine the precision and consistency of the stamped parts. During the assessment, request past case studies from the manufacturer: for example, whether they have produced complex stamped parts similar to their own products (such as automotive parts with deep-drawn structures or micro-electronic connectors), and check whether the dimensional tolerances and surface smoothness of the stamped parts in these cases meet the requirements.
Furthermore, it is necessary to understand the maintenance and iteration capabilities of metal stamping toolings. Reliable manufacturers will maintain tooling ledgers, regularly inspect mold cutting edges and guide mechanisms to avoid burrs and dimensional deviations in stamped parts due to tooling wear; when product design adjustments are needed, they can quickly optimize the tooling structure instead of requiring external stamping die manufacturers to make modifications, which can significantly shorten the R&D and trial production cycle.
Whole-Process Quality Control of Precision Metal Stamping Company
Quality problems in metal stamping parts (such as cracking, deformation, and dimensional deviations) often stem from a lack of a comprehensive quality control system in the metal stamping company. When selecting a metal stamping company, it is crucial to understand its quality control process. Does the raw material stage involve supplier qualification verification and incoming inspection (such as random checks of steel plate thickness and hardness) to avoid using inferior materials? During the stamping process, is there online inspection (such as real-time inspection of surface defects using a vision system), rather than relying solely on manual sampling? In the finished product stage, is there full-dimensional inspection (such as using a coordinate measuring machine to check key dimensions) and performance testing (such as tensile strength and salt spray resistance tests) to ensure that each batch of products meets standards?
Service and After-Sales Support of Precision Metal Stamping Factory
Good service and after-sales support are crucial for long-term cooperation. The service capabilities of a precision metal stamping factory are reflected in its initial communication and subsequent response: Does it proactively address product needs and provide process optimization suggestions (e.g., suggesting staged stamping for complex structures to reduce costs)? Does it support small-batch trial production to help companies verify product design feasibility and avoid the risks of direct mass production?
It’s essential to confirm whether the metal stamping factory has a clear after-sales response mechanism. For example, can it dispatch technical personnel within 24 hours and provide a solution within 48 hours in case of quality issues? Can it promptly offer returns, exchanges, or replacements for defective products? Some high-quality precision metal stamping factories also provide “one-stop service,” covering post-stamping surface treatment (electroplating, spraying), CNC finishing, etc., reducing the hassle of dealing with multiple suppliers and improving production efficiency.

Choosing the right precision metal stamping supplier not only ensures stable product quality but also reduces communication costs and cooperation risks. By comprehensively evaluating the above four dimensions and conducting on-site inspections (checking the workshop environment, equipment status, and testing processes), you can find a reliable partner that matches your needs and safeguards the production of precision metal parts.
